CACI International Inc is hiring: Full Stack Web Developer in Spr...
CACI International Inc - Springfield, VA, United States, 22161
Work at CACI International Inc
Overview
- View job
Overview
Join to apply for the Full Stack Web Developer role at CACI International Inc
Job Details
- Job Category: Information Technology
- Time Type: Full time
- Minimum Clearance Required to Start: TS/SCI with Polygraph
- Employee Type: Regular
- Percentage of Travel Required: None
- Type of Travel: None
The Opportunity
CACI is seeking a Full Stack Web Developer to create custom enterprise web application solutions to support the National Security Mission. The candidate will have extensive knowledge of system implementation and full project lifecycle experience on multiple projects. We are seeking candidates with substantial experience in full stack web application development, implementation, and maintenance best practices.
Responsibilities
- Design, develop, build, and deploy custom cloud-based web applications on both Windows and Linux OS
- Code custom front-end web applications, RESTful APIs, and back-end data logic and updates
- Develop modern User Interfaces primarily leveraging Angular framework
- Utilize various Amazon Web Services (AWS) offerings in support of application development
- Provide production support and system monitoring, investigating customer inquiries or data requests
- Make recommendations for best technical design to meet customer requirements
- Bring passion for UX design
- Continuously innovate to automate processes, implement best practices, and improve overall system architecture
- Actively engage with the team for sprint planning, testing coordination, demonstrations, and retrospectives
Qualifications
Required:
- Active Top Secret or Top Secret SCI clearance with ability to successfully complete a polygraph
- BS in Computer Science, Mathematics, or other technical discipline
- 5+ years of experience in software development
- Strong front-end web development skills: HTML, CSS, JavaScript
- Familiarity with modern front-end JavaScript libraries or frameworks, such as Angular or React
- Experience building modern, user-friendly web applications
- Strong client-facing skills and ability to interact with client leadership
- Experience with NoSQL databases
- Experience with API development (SOAP, REST, HTTP, XML, JSON)
- Experience with source control systems, Git, GitLab
- Familiarity with AWS services (EC2, S3, SNS, Lambda, SQS)
Desired:
- Development experience with MEAN Stack (MongoDB, Express, Angular, Node)
- Strong experience in Angular
- Familiarity with MarkLogic databases
- Experience with SQL databases
- Familiarity with PeopleSoft
- Familiarity with ColdFusion
- Experience using Bash commands
- DevOps experience with GitLab CI/CD pipelines
What You Can Expect
A culture of integrity. At CACI, we prioritize character and innovation, supporting our team in high performance and dedication to our customers’ missions.
An environment of trust. We value diverse contributions and offer flexible time off and learning resources to help you grow.
A focus on continuous growth. Together, we advance critical missions and foster your career development.
Your potential is limitless. So is ours.
Compensation & Benefits
Salary range: $68,400 - $143,700, influenced by location, experience, skills, and education. We offer comprehensive benefits including healthcare, wellness, retirement, education, and time off.
Additional Information
This position can be located in multiple locations; the salary range reflects the national average.
Equal Opportunity Employer. All qualified applicants will receive consideration regardless of race, color, religion, sex, pregnancy, sexual orientation, age, national origin, disability, veteran status, or other protected characteristics.
#J-18808-Ljbffr